Fraudster dupes MBBS aspirants of Rs. 70 lakh on pretext of providing admission.

Mangalore Today Network-1

Mangaluru: July 2, 2015: A case has been registered at Ullal police station by an estate owner against a Fraudster for duping him of Rs. 70 lakh with a fake promise of providing medical seats to three students at a medical college.

The accused has been identified as Vikram Kumar who runs an education service in Bengaluru called ’Career Guidance’.


Vikram kumar had assured the Victim Subbaiah, that he would help three students in getting medical seats at a medical college in Mangaluru. He asked Subbaiah to pay Rs 36 lakh for each student.


On June 11, Vikram took advance of Rs. 6 lakh from Subbaiah as 2 lakh each from three students at a hotel in Mangaluru.  Vikram took the three students to the Medical College on June 29 Monday and collected the required documents from the college. He asked the students to wait at the reception and left the college.


When Vikram did not return to the college, the students phoned him and found that his mobile was switched off. The students then asked the college management about Vikram, they said they were not aware of who he was.


Realizing that they were duped, the students then informed Subbaiah about the incident who then registered a complaint at the police station. Vikram allegedly took 70 lakh from three students.
